Sony H300 vs Sony ZV-1 Overview

Below is a comprehensive analysis of the Sony H300 vs Sony ZV-1, former being a Small Sensor Superzoom while the latter is a Large Sensor Compact and they are both manufactured by Sony. The image resolution of the H300 (20MP) and the ZV-1 (20MP) is relatively well matched but the H300 (1/2.3") and ZV-1 (1") provide different sensor sizes.

The H300 was launched 7 years before the ZV-1 and that is quite a large difference as far as tech is concerned. The two cameras have different body design with the Sony H300 being a SLR-like (bridge) camera and the Sony ZV-1 being a Large Sensor Compact camera.

Sony H300 vs Sony ZV-1 Physical Comparison

When you are intending to lug around your camera, you will have to factor its weight and dimensions. The Sony H300 comes with exterior measurements of 130mm x 95mm x 122mm (5.1" x 3.7" x 4.8") along with a weight of 590 grams (1.30 lbs) and the Sony ZV-1 has dimensions of 105mm x 60mm x 44mm (4.1" x 2.4" x 1.7") along with a weight of 294 grams (0.65 lbs).

Sony H300 vs Sony ZV-1 Sensor Comparison

Generally, it is difficult to imagine the contrast between sensor measurements merely by looking at technical specs. The photograph here will help offer you a greater sense of the sensor measurements in the H300 and ZV-1.

As you have seen, the two cameras provide the same resolution albeit different sensor measurements. The H300 includes the tinier sensor which is going to make obtaining shallow depth of field trickier. The older H300 is going to be disadvantaged when it comes to sensor technology.
